Rescue underway after searchers find missing plane on Kenai Peninsula
- A man and two children were found with non-life-threatening injuries near the wreckage of a small plane on Alaska's Kenai Peninsula.
- The pilot and two juveniles were taken to a hospital after the plane was located near Tustumena Lake, confirmed by Alaska State Troopers' spokesperson Austin McDaniel.
- The Alaska Army National Guard rescued the three individuals from the plane at approximately 10:30 am on Monday morning.
- The Alaska State Troopers acknowledged the assistance from the Alaska Army National Guard, US Coast Guard, and others in the operation.

Three rescued after surviving small plane crash in Alaska
(NBC, KYMA/KECY) - A man and two children were rescued Monday in Alaska after surviving a small plane crash on a frozen lake. The flight was listed as overdue late Sunday night and search efforts began. About 12 hours later, a pilot taking part in that search took photos showing the wreckage of the Piper PA-12 Super Cruiser and the three survivors. "I was really shocked. 3 survivors rescued from icy lake after plane goes missing in Alaska
Alaska National Guard (SOLDOTNA, ALASKA) — Good Samaritans helped save stranded plane crash victims on Monday after their aircraft went missing over a mountain range in Alaska. A Piper PA-12 Super Cruiser was reported overdue on Sunday night, according to the Alaska National Guard. Man and 2 Children Found Alive After Alaska Plane Crash
JUNEAU, Alaska—A man and two children were found with injuries that were not life-threatening Monday near the wreckage of a small plane on Alaska’s Kenai Peninsula that had been reported overdue the night before, authorities said. The three—the pilot and two juveniles—were taken to a hospital after the plane’s wreckage was discovered Monday morning near the east side of Tustumena Lake, according to the Alaska State Troopers.
